12 Walworth Terrace, Sandyford
Now known as 100 Elderslie Street.

No occupants given until 1860

1860-61    Frame, Colin, bookbinder, 90 Mitchell Street

1860-63    Millar, Wm. (of Hewit, Millars & Co., merchants, warehousemen & manufacturers, 44 Ingram St.)

1860-72    Muir, Wm., engineer, 85 Clyde Street, Anderston

1860-64    Owen, Thomas, veneer cutter, Whitehall Veneer Sawmill, 30 Whitehall St., Anderston

1861-62    Ralston, Peter, photographer & calotypist, 195.5 Argyle St. & 11 Jamaica St.

1861-62    Robertson, Mrs.

1862-66    Clarke, Daniel, 83 Miller Street

1862-64    Learmouth, Wm., commission merchant, 4 Stormont Street

1863-65    Barclay, Thomas (of Barclay, Phillips & Co., ship-furnishing ironmongers & brassfounders, 17 Anderston Quay)

1863-68    Forrest, John, wholesale & retail grocer, 1 Stobcross St. & 399 Gallowgate

1864-66    McIntyre, A.

1864-66    Ure, Mrs.

1865-67    Crawford, Mrs.

1865-69    Hill, David

1866-69    Buchanan, Dr. (of Buchanan Brothers, chemists & druggists, Western Apothecaries' Hall, 275 Argyle St.)

1866-72    Muir, Hugh (of Muir & Caldwell, engineers, Scotia Engine Works, 116 Elliot St.)

1867-72    McLean, Peter (of Harvie & McGavin, grain millers, Anderston Grain Mills, 27 Washington St.)

1868-71    Garie, John

1868-73    Garie, Mrs./Miss

1868-70    Minto, James

1869-70    Barr, Albany P.

1869-73    McDougall, Wm. (at F. Watson, baker, cook & confectioner, 8 Charing Cross & 166 Sauchiehall St.)

1870-71    Liddell, Charles, surveyor, Gas Office, 42 Virginia St.

1873-84    Feltoe, Francis, Inland Revenue officer, bonded store, 7 Wellington St.

1874-75    Aitken, Peter, jeweller & gas engineer, 21 Egyptian Halls

1874-76    Paterson, Mrs.

1875-76    Stewart, J.

1876-77    Cockburn, Wm. jun., veterinary surgeon, M.R.V.C.S., 112 North St.

1876-78    Munro, Allen

1876-77    Munro, Donald, teacher, 94 Duke Street

1877-78    Jamieson, James, iron merchant, 79 Robertson St.

1877-79    Mollison, Mrs. Wm., sen.

1878-82    Mollison, Miss

1879-81    Mollison, George (at Brand & Mollison, dyers, 66 Renfield St. & Napiershall dyeworks, 244-248 North Woodside Road)

1880-90    McGaw, Capt. John (at David MacBrayne, steamship owner, 119 Hope St.)

1880-81    Russell, Lewis, plumber and gasfitter, 342 St. Vincent St.

1881-85    Feltoe, S. & E., dressmakers and milliners

1881-90    Hutcheson, John (of Hutcheson & McCathie, wrights, 18 Terrace St. & 2 Bothwell Circus)

1881-91    McArthur, Wm., tailor and clothier, 341 Argyle St.

1883-86    McLean, Mrs. Peter

1886-88    McLean, John

1886-88    Munro, Robert, railway waggon & lorry waterproof cover tarpaulin manufacturer, steam pipe & boiler coverer & non-conducting cement manufacturer, 52 Bishop St., Anderston

1886-89    Munro, Mrs. Robert

1887-89    Lindsay, Geo. G. (of Wm. Lindsay & Sons, plumbers and gasfitters, 165 Holm St.)

1889-92    Lindsay, Misses, dressmakers

1889-91    McKinnon, R.S.

1889-94    Polyklinik Dispensary

1890-91    McArthur, Andrew, accountant & property factor, 53 Waterloo St.

1890-92    Taylor, Miss Fanny, dressmaker

1891-92    Gilmour, Hugh, wine & spirit merchant, 21 Elderslie St. & 7 Greenhill St.

1891-93    MacLeod, Hugh, writer (of Ramsay & Macleod, writers, 194 St. Vincent St.)

1891-93    Spence, David, ironmonger & shopfitter, 83 Stockwell St. & 41 Robertson Lane

1892    Hunter, Daniel, corn factor, 27 Hope St.

1893-94    Barrowman, John (of J. Barrowman & Son, lime merchants & burners, 76 Lancefield St.)

1894-98    Adam, Thomas, dispensing chemist & optician, 440 St. Vincent St.

1898    Johnstone, John, cashier (at Edward & Sons, gold & silver smiths, gem merchants, watch makers, 92-96 Buchanan St.)

1898-1903    McLean, Wm., cycle agent, 345-347 St. Vincent St.

1900-02    Campbell, Alex.

1901-05    McKinnon, Hugh

1902-07    Ormond, James, hosier, 42 Candleriggs

1902-04    Rankin, J.

1903-05    McGregor, John, flour sack merchant, 10 Catherine Place, Anderston

1905    McDougall, M.

1905    Dunn, Miss

1906-09    Laird, Mrs.

1907    Arneil, James (of J. Buchanan & Co., coach & motor car builders, 145 North St.)

1907-11    Glen, Charles (of Charles Glen & Co., manufacturing chemists, drysalters, wall paper dealers, fancy goods & wholesale general merchants, 162 Kent Road)

1907-11    McDougall, Samuel, tailor and clothier, 848 Argyle St.
